Are you an experienced Workshop Supervisor ready for your next career move to a Company that really values your contribution and can offer you award-winning training opportunities? People truly are at the heart of our business and we believe in empowering our colleagues to develop their skills, make decisions and take on new responsibilities.

As a Workshop Supervisor you will haveresponsibility for running the busy Workshop and team of fitters, ensuring that all targets are achieved and customers are satisfied with the Service. On a day-day basis you and your team will maintain, repair and prepare for hire all types of equipment within our range worth more than £1m.

The Key duties as a Workshop Supervisor will include;

  • Places orders for spares and consumables in line with Company authorisation limits remaining within monthly and annual budgets.
  • Prioritise the repair of equipment that is scheduled to go on-hire or is routinely in high demand by ensuring that no more than 5% of hireable assets are on repair at any one time.
  • Ensure that all Pre-Hires are completed in a timely manner in line with customer order requirements
  • Directly manages a team of Fitters being responsible for their performance and conduct at work.

To succeed as a Workshop Supervisor you will bring the following skill-set and behaviours:

  • Experience of managing and developing a team of employees in a workshop environment
  • Experience of maintaining relevant equipment in a workshop environment
  • Experience of achieving targets and working within a set budget
  • Good communication skills and IT literate
  • Qualified to NVQ Plant Maintenance Level 3 (or willing to undergo training and assessment to this level)
